Description:
With increasing amounts of data flooding complex networks, the risk of stolen or lost information continues to rise. In December of 2004, the Payment Card Industry (PCI) Data Security Standard (DSS) was adopted by all major credit card companies, including Visa, MasterCard, American Express, Discover and JCB. The PCI data security standard is a comprehensive set of requirements designed to prevent fraud and protect consumer privacy when sensitive customer data is transmitted over the web and stored on an organization’s network. All financial institutions, merchants, vendors and their agents that use "system components" to store, process, or transmit cardholder data on their networks are required to meet the PCI standard.
